On itunes if there is a letter typed in the search bar on the top right hand corner than only the songs that start with that letter will appear in you iTunes library. If there are multiple letters typed in the search bar and none of your songs begin with those letters than nothing will appear. Make sure all the letters in the search bar on the top right have been deleted.
